1796 Cavalry Sword with older blade
One of my favourite things I have picked up for a while lovely old 1796 cavalry sword with an earlier inscribed blade of about. 1750/60s , some damage to grip which is repairable but I think that adds to the charm of this very special sword , the blade has lots of old inscriptions to it , if swords could talk I am sure this one would have a very interesting story to tell , displays so well
